There are many tourist attractions , restaurants and parks in London which are accessible. But, my favorite accessible place is Southwark Park Pavilion Cafe in London. The main reason for this place being my favourite is that It’s very near to my home and is my go-to place to enjoy quality family time ! The place is fully accessible and is pet and kid friendly with amazing views !

Situated inside the Southwark Park, this Café has a lake to the west, a nearby cricket oval to the southeast and the neighbouring building of the Southwark Park Galleries to the northeast. All the three sides of the Café offer seating surrounded by lush greenery on two sides and lake view on another side which makes one enjoy food in the vicinity of nature ! They serve amazing food and authentic dishes including full English breakfasts, freshly baked pizzas, variety of ice-creams, healthy sandwiches and salads, brewed hot drinks and even cold beverages. The Gallo counter inside serves some of the best ice-cream flavour combos like peanut butter,lemon-banana , strawberry-caramel, coffee-ferrero rocher, nutella-passion fruit , etc. They also have seasonal specials.If you enjoy ice-creams and wish to know about Unique Gelato spots in London , do read the post on Connect. They offer click and collect and takeaway currently which you can enjoy by sitting at their spaced outdoor seating(yes, enjoy a lake view or a lush greenery view with a cricket ground where you can enjoy having food or your coffee while you watch a live cricket match ! ) Everyone across ages can spend a good time there . The Café is dog-friendly and Dogs are allowed inside but must be kept on a lead at all times.

The Café is fully accessible with accessible entrance , accessible toilet and accessible seating area (both indoors and outdoors). They have diaper changing facilities in all the toilets. Even the Café from inside has seating in such a manner that a wheelchair person or a stroller can easily pass, making the Café accessible inside too.
